Skip to content

Instantly share code, notes, and snippets.

@bretkikehara
Last active November 5, 2018 07:13
Show Gist options
  • Save bretkikehara/25a528868ea71f7c72229b89dbba4dab to your computer and use it in GitHub Desktop.
Save bretkikehara/25a528868ea71f7c72229b89dbba4dab to your computer and use it in GitHub Desktop.
generate valid localhost certificates for chrome
# https://github.com/OpenVPN/easy-rsa
./easyrsa \
--batch \
--dn-mode=org \
--req-c="US" \
--req-st="California" \
--req-city="SF" \
--req-org="Copyleft Certificate Co" \
--req-email=me@example.net \
--req-ou="My Organizational Unit" \
--req-cn="my-local-ca" \
build-ca
./easyrsa \
--batch \
--dn-mode=org \
--req-c="US" \
--req-st="California" \
--req-city="SF" \
--req-org="Copyleft Certificate Co" \
--req-email=me@example.net \
--req-ou="My Organizational Unit" \
--req-cn="mylocaldomain.com" \
--subject-alt-name="DNS:mylocaldomain.com,DNS:*.mylocaldomain.com,DNS:*.ctrl.mylocaldomain.com" \
build-server-full \
'mylocaldomain.com'
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ment